QR Code Maker Playground

Choose your content type, customize the design, and download your QR code in seconds. No signup required.

Gradient Foreground

PNG, JPG, or WebP. Logo is embedded in the center of the QR code. Use High error correction for best results.

🎨

Your QR code will appear here

Enter your content and click "Make Your QR Code"

What Makes QRMint the Best QR Code Maker?

Full customization power without the complexity — and completely free.

QRMint is a free online QR code maker that gives you complete control over every visual detail. Unlike basic generators that produce a plain black square, QRMint lets you choose custom foreground and background colors, apply linear or radial gradient fills, select from four module shapes (square, rounded, dots, classy), and pick from four eye styles to make your QR code truly unique. Add a professional frame template with a custom call-to-action label, and embed your own logo directly in the center for a branded result.

Every QR code type is supported: URLs, plain text, WiFi credentials, email, phone, SMS, vCard contacts, calendar events, EPC payment codes, and geographic locations. Export your finished design as a high-resolution PNG (up to 2048×2048 px) or as an infinitely scalable SVG — perfect for anything from a business card to a large-format banner. Style presets can be saved and reused across multiple codes for consistent branding.

No account is ever needed. QRMint is free forever and works entirely in your browser. For teams and developers who need to generate codes programmatically, the same capabilities are available via the free REST API — no authentication, no rate limits for standard use, and no watermarks on any output.

Who Uses an Online QR Code Maker

From freelancers to enterprises — anyone who needs to connect the physical and digital worlds.

💼

Business Cards

Replace a wall of contact details with a single scannable QR code that encodes your full vCard. Prospects scan it and your name, phone, email, company, and website land directly in their contacts app. Pair with your brand colors and logo for a polished, modern impression that stands out at every networking event.

📢

Marketing Materials

Bridge print and digital by embedding a QR code on flyers, posters, brochures, and direct mail. Link to a landing page, promotional video, or special offer. Customize the QR code to match your campaign colors so it feels like an intentional design element rather than an afterthought. Track clicks via the destination URL.

🏷️

Product Labels

Add a QR code to product packaging that links to usage instructions, ingredients, warranty registration, or a product demo video. Manufacturers can generate codes in bulk using the REST API and integrate them directly into the label print workflow. SVG output ensures pixel-perfect reproduction at any label size.

📱

Social Media

Create a branded QR code that links to your profile, portfolio, or latest content drop. Share it in Stories, print it on merchandise, or add it to your email signature. A custom-colored code with your profile image as the logo makes for a distinctive, shareable visual that reinforces your personal brand identity.

🎓

Education

Teachers and trainers can embed QR codes on worksheets, handouts, and classroom posters that link to supplementary videos, quizzes, or resource libraries. Students scan with their phone and are instantly taken to the right content. Generate different codes for different difficulty levels and print them all at once using QRMint's batch API endpoint.

🛒

Retail

Place QR codes on shelf talkers, price tags, and window displays to link shoppers to product reviews, loyalty programs, or online purchase options. WiFi QR codes let customers connect to your in-store network without asking for the password. Custom frame templates like "Scan for Offer" make the call to action immediately clear even to first-time scanners.

How to Make a QR Code Online

Three steps. Under a minute. No account needed.

1. Choose Your Content Type

Select the type of information you want to encode: a URL, plain text, WiFi network, email address, phone number, SMS, vCard contact, calendar event, EPC payment, or geographic location. Fill in the relevant fields and QRMint builds the correct payload format automatically.

2. Customize Your Design

Pick foreground and background colors, or enable a gradient fill for a modern look. Choose a module shape and eye style, then optionally apply a branded frame template with custom text. Upload your logo to embed it in the center. Save your style as a preset for future codes.

3. Download & Use

Click Generate and your QR code renders instantly in the preview. Download as PNG for standard digital and print use, or choose SVG for infinitely scalable output ideal for large-format printing. No watermark, no attribution required — the code is yours to use however you need.

Why QRMint Is the Best Free QR Code Maker

Every feature you need. No signup, no limits, no catch.

🎨

Full Color Customization

Go beyond black and white. Set any foreground and background color using the color picker or by entering a hex code directly. Enable linear or radial gradient fills with adjustable angle and two color stops. Six built-in color presets — Classic, Inverted, Cyberpunk, Neon, Corporate, Gold — get you started in one click.

🔹

Multiple Module Styles

Choose from four module shapes: Square (classic), Rounded (soft corners), Dots (circular modules), and Classy (mixed corner styles). Combine with four eye shape options — Square, Rounded, Circle, and Leaf — for a QR code that is distinctly yours. All style combinations remain fully scannable.

📷

Logo Embedding

Upload a PNG, JPG, or WebP image and QRMint centres it inside the QR pattern. For best results, use High (30%) error correction so the code remains scannable even with the logo covering part of the data area. Ideal for branded marketing materials, business cards, and social media content where recognition matters.

💾

High-Resolution Output

Export PNG at 256, 512, 1024, or 2048 px — sharp enough for a billboard. Choose SVG for infinite scalability with zero quality loss at any reproduction size. No watermarks or attribution are added to your downloaded files. Both formats are available for every QR code type, completely free.

QR Code Maker FAQ

Is QRMint really free to use?

Yes, completely free — no hidden fees, no premium tier, and no trial period. QRMint is free forever for both the web-based QR code maker and the REST API. You do not need to create an account, provide an email address, or enter a credit card. Every feature — including custom colors, logo embedding, frame templates, and SVG export — is available at no cost.

Can I add my logo to the QR code?

Yes. In the playground above, scroll to the Logo section and click "Upload Logo". QRMint accepts PNG, JPG, and WebP files and embeds the image in the center of the QR pattern. To keep the code reliably scannable with a logo present, set Error Correction to High (30%) in the Options section. This reserves enough redundant data in the QR pattern to compensate for the area covered by the logo.

What formats can I download?

QRMint supports two output formats. PNG is a raster image available at 256, 512, 1024, or 2048 px — suitable for websites, presentations, and standard print. SVG is a vector format that scales to any size without quality loss, making it the best choice for large-format print such as banners, signage, and packaging. Both formats are available for every QR code type and are downloaded without any watermark.

How many QR codes can I make at once?

Using the web-based QR code maker you generate one code at a time. For bulk generation, use the QRMint REST API, which supports batch requests of up to 500 QR codes per call. Each code in a batch can have its own content, colors, and style settings, making the API ideal for generating personalized codes for product labels, event tickets, or direct mail campaigns. No API key or authentication is required.

Do QR codes created with QRMint expire?

No. QRMint generates static QR codes — the content is encoded directly in the pattern at the time of creation and is permanent. There are no dynamic redirects, no hosted short links, and no expiration dates. Your QR code will continue to work as long as the destination URL or content it encodes remains valid. QRMint does not store or track any data from codes you generate.

Need a specific QR code type? QRMint also generates URL, vCard, Email, Phone, SMS, WiFi, Event, and Payment QR codes — all free, no signup, with the same full styling options.

Make Your QR Code Now

Free forever. No signup. No API key. Download PNG or SVG instantly.

Make Your QR Code →
Part of the SoftVoyagers Ecosystem